Heads-up for the security pass on Quillbox formula sandboxing: every sandbox image is now built reproducibly, with provenance attached at publish time. User-supplied formulas only ever execute inside that pinned image — no fallback to host interpreters, we ripped that path out entirely. If you want to audit the escape-hatch removal, it landed in one commit and the attestation covers it. The sandbox image in question is identified below.

trace token, bagag-fahag: htk21_1a5003b533f7b0cca4331

## Onboarding — Date Localization in Tidings

Welcome! Tidings renders dates in 14 locales, and yes, that's as fun as it sounds. All format rules live in the `locale_formats` table, not in code — resist the urge to hardcode anything, past maintainers learned that the hard way. The formatter service reads the table on boot and caches it, so edits need a restart to show up. To browse the current rules and try changes locally, connect to the dev database with the connection string below.

primary connection of yagep-kahip = redis://giliel_svc:zYiKsLL2PLpfPL@db-348f.xolmarsys.corp:5432/fenwyn

The Orvane Labs bike cage and the east and west parking gates operate on separate access schedules, and facilities desk staff should note that visitor vehicles may only use the west gate between 07:00 and 19:00. Cyclists requesting cage access must show a valid day pass, and their details should be entered in the access ledger before the cage is opened. Gates must never be propped open, even briefly, during deliveries. When a manual override is required at either gate, use the code below.

staff pass of fadup-fawig = bdg-FUNKS-4

- [ ] **Step 7: Breaker override escrow.** After sealing the signing keys for the Tallgrove upstream API circuit breaker, confirm the support team can force the breaker open during a full outage. The override bundle lives in the sealed escrow drawer and is useless without its unlock phrase. Two ceremony witnesses must initial this step before proceeding. The escrow bundle is decrypted with the recovery passphrase that follows.

vault phrase of kahip-kahop = holath-quenmir